Mark M. Davis, born on May 18, 1955, is an American businessman who holds a unique position in the sports world. He is the controlling owner and managing general partner of the Las Vegas Raiders, a well-known NFL team. He also owns the Las Vegas Aces, a successful WNBA team. His father, Al Davis, was a principal figure in the Raiders' history, and Mark has carried on that family legacy, you know.

The Evolution of Mark Davis' Net Worth
When people ask, "How much is Mark Davis' net worth?" the answer isn't just a single number; it's a story of significant financial growth. His wealth has seen a truly remarkable increase over the past few years. For instance, back in 2016, his estimated net worth was around $500 million, which is a lot of money, obviously.
Fast forward to more recent times, and that figure has grown substantially. According to Forbes' billionaires list, his net worth has climbed to an estimated $2.3 billion. This kind of jump is pretty striking, you know, and it reflects a lot of factors, particularly the increasing value of his sports teams. It's quite a financial journey, in some respects.
This growth is tied to the success and rising valuations of his sports franchises. The business of professional sports, especially the NFL, has seen incredible expansion, and Mark Davis's ownership has put him right in the middle of that. So, his personal wealth has, very, mirrored the fortunes of his teams. It's a clear connection, basically.

The Raiders' Relocation and Valuation Growth
A significant event that greatly impacted Mark Davis's net worth was the relocation of the Raiders. He moved the team from Oakland to Las Vegas in 2020. This move came after an earlier attempt to relocate to Los Angeles didn't work out. The decision to bring the team to Las Vegas was a big step, and it has had major financial consequences, as a matter of fact.
When Mark Davis first took over the team, Forbes valued the Raiders at $761 million. This was a substantial amount, of course, but it was just the beginning. The move to a new, state-of-the-art stadium in a new market like Las Vegas, you know, proved to be a very smart business decision. It really changed things for the team's financial outlook.
Today, the value of the Raiders has skyrocketed. The team is now worth an incredible $6.7 billion. This massive increase in team value is a primary reason why Mark Davis's personal net worth has seen such a dramatic rise. The move to Las Vegas, in a way, was a pivotal moment for both the team and its owner's fortune. It's quite a transformation, basically.
Success with the Las Vegas Aces
Mark Davis's financial success isn't just about the NFL. He also owns the Las Vegas Aces, a WNBA team, and their performance has been truly remarkable. In 2023, after his team won its second straight WNBA championship, Mark Davis shared that it felt "fantastic." This feeling, you know, comes from seeing his team achieve such high levels of success.
Before his ownership, the Aces had not won any championships in 25 years. However, under Davis's guidance, the team suddenly began to dominate. They won championships in both 2022 and 2023 and have continued to perform very well. This success on the court also contributes to the team's value and, by extension, to Mark Davis's overall wealth, as a matter of fact.
The WNBA is a growing league, and owning a successful, championship-winning team like the Aces places Mark Davis in a strong position within that market. It shows his ability to build and manage winning franchises, not just in football but in basketball as well. This diversified ownership, in some respects, adds another layer to his financial standing. It's pretty impressive, actually.
